    Abstract: A data writing element may be configured at least with a write pole positioned adjacent a first shield along a first axis and adjacent a second shield along a second axis. The second shield may be separated from the write pole by a first gap distance on an air bearing surface (ABS) and by a second gap distance distal the ABS with the first and second gap distances meeting at a transition surface oriented parallel to the ABS.

    Abstract: A data storage system may have at least one data writer that incorporates a write pole that continuously extends from an air bearing surface. The write pole can be separated from the air bearing surface by a side shield that consists of a first magnetic layer positioned on the air bearing surface and a guard layer separated from the air bearing surface by the first magnetic layer. The guard layer may be configured with a different magnetic saturation flux density than the first magnetic layer.
